Meanings

to stop a recurring pattern of behavior or events, often negative, that has been repeated over time.

She decided to break the cycle of poverty by pursuing higher education.

to disrupt a sequence of events or actions that lead to a particular outcome, often to prevent negative consequences.

By addressing the root causes, the organization aims to break the cycle of violence in the community.
